That drunken Kraut is in the house before the station. My recommendation is to take one man only and move slowly along the way to the right side of the rails. Take out a guard walking down the street and two chatting Germanz at an intersection with DeLisle or so. Then move swiftly to that first house to the left of the road - mind that fellow on top of the roof, take him out or spare him if he doesn't see you - get in and shoot the drunken officer in the second room. Capture the hun in the bedroom and take his cloth and then run into the station. After the cut-scene I left that guy alone in the right corner of the room with a MP40 and mowed down anything with two legs from the outside.
